Exactly How Solar Panels Generate Electricity



Solar panels harness the sun's energy by converting sunlight into electricity via a process called the photovoltaic effect. When sunlight hits the photovoltaic panels, the photons (light particles) are taken in by the semiconducting materials within the panels, usually made of silicon. This absorption produces an electric current as the photons knock electrons loose from the atoms within the product.

The electric fields within the solar cells then compel these electrons to flow in a particular instructions, producing a direct existing (DC) of power. This direct current is after that passed through an inverter, which transforms it right into alternating current (A/C) electrical energy that can be utilized to power your home or business.

Excess electrical energy produced by the photovoltaic panels can be kept in batteries for later usage or fed back into the grid for credit score with a process called internet metering. Comprehending Photovoltaic Panel Components



One vital facet of photovoltaic panel innovation is comprehending the numerous elements that compose a solar panel system.

The key components of a photovoltaic panel system consist of the photovoltaic panels themselves, which are composed of photovoltaic cells that convert sunlight right into electrical energy. These panels are installed on a structure, commonly a roof covering, to record sunlight.

In addition to the panels, there are inverters that transform the direct current (DC) power created by the panels right into rotating present (AIR CONDITIONER) power that can be made use of in homes or organizations.

The system additionally includes racking to support and place the solar panels for optimal sunshine exposure. In addition, cables and adapters are important for carrying the electrical power created by the panels to the electrical system of a building.

Last but not least, a tracking system may be consisted of to track the efficiency of the photovoltaic panel system and guarantee it's functioning effectively.
